Playwright Kobina Ansah has intimated that he wrote all the songs for his new original musical, In The Pants Of A Woman, which shows this April at National Theatre. The playwright is known for plays such as The Boy Called A Girl, Once Upon A Riddle, and Emergency Wedding among others.
In The Pants Of A Woman is an original musical play themed on rape. The first of its kind in Ghana, it aims at empowering victims to speak out. In his last play, Once Upon A Riddle, the playwright wrote 14 original songs.
In The Pants Of A Woman has 16 songs. He explained, “It is by God’s grace I write songs. I don’t play any musical instrument, but I hear a voice singing a melody in my subconscious mind. That is how I record what I hear as songs.” He added that he works with his team to refine what he writes.
In The Pants Of A Woman shows on Saturday, April 20th and Sunday, April 21st, 2024 at National Theatre on 3pm and 7pm each day.
